Archaea and bacteria reveal the ancient origins of another ‘eukaryotic’ complex. Membrane trafficking is old… check this out for an integrative approach showing how bioinformatics and computational structural methods marry with x-ray crystallography and cryo EM to reveal biology in all its beauty.🧶🧬

The prokaryotic origins of the COMMD protein family involved in eukaryotic membrane trafficking - Nature Communications

COMMD proteins assemble into a heterodecameric ring in the Commander complex, which plays a role in endosomal membrane trafficking and signalling in eukaryotes. Here, Liu et al. identify COMMD-like pr...

So nice to see this story! Jan is like a dog with a bone chasing this down. The origin of alpha/beta tubulins has been a question he won’t let go of. Great collaborative team effort and careful work. Recommended 🧬🧶

Thijs J. G. Ettema 🦠🔬🇳🇱🇸🇪🇪🇺@ettema.bsky.social · 6mo ago

Our latest preprint: Together with the team of Jan Löwe, @danieltamarit.bsky.social and many others we discovered and characterized several Asgard tubulin genes and propose that microtubule architecture and dynamics evolved in Asgard archaea prior to eukaryogenesis www.biorxiv.org/content/10.6...
